dba是什么(dba是什么单位名称)
简介:
DBA(Database Administrator),中文翻译为数据库管理员,是负责管理和维护数据库系统的专业人员。DBA在企业中扮演着至关重要的角色,负责确保数据库系统的稳定性、安全性和高效性。
一、DBA的职责
1. 数据库设计和创建:DBA负责设计数据库结构,创建数据库表格和索引等,保证数据库的合理性和高效性。
2. 数据库备份和恢复:DBA制定备份策略,确保数据库数据的安全性,以便在出现故障时能够及时恢复数据。
3. 性能调优:DBA监控数据库的性能指标,识别瓶颈并进行调优,保证数据库系统的高效运行。
4. 安全管理:DBA负责设置用户权限、访问控制和加密等措施,保护数据库免受未授权访问和恶意攻击。
5. 故障诊断和处理:DBA负责监控数据库系统的运行情况,及时发现并解决故障,确保数据库系统的稳定性和可靠性。
6. 数据迁移和升级:DBA负责数据迁移、数据库版本升级等工作,确保数据库系统的可持续发展。
二、DBA的技能要求
1. 熟悉数据库技术:DBA需要熟悉各种数据库管理系统(如Oracle、SQL Server、MySQL等)的原理和使用方法。
2. 数据建模能力:DBA需要具备数据建模和设计能力,能够根据业务需求设计数据库结构。
3. SQL编程能力:DBA需要熟练掌握SQL语言,能够编写复杂的SQL查询和存储过程。
4. 熟悉操作系统和网络知识:DBA需要熟悉操作系统和网络的知识,能够与系统管理员和网络工程师协作进行问题排查和解决。
5. 熟练掌握数据库性能调优技术:DBA需要了解数据库性能调优的方法和工具,能够对数据库进行优化,提升系统性能。
三、DBA的职业发展
DBA是一个有前途的职业,随着企业数字化和数据化的发展,对DBA的需求不断增加。具备丰富经验和技术能力的DBA往往能够获得更高的薪资和职业发展机会,可以逐步晋升为高级DBA、数据库架构师等职位。
总结:
作为数据库系统的管理者,DBA在企业中具有重要的地位和作用,对数据库系统的稳定性和安全性起着关键作用。要成为一名优秀的DBA,需要具备扎实的数据库技术知识、丰富的实战经验和良好的沟通能力,不断学习和提升自己的技能,以应对不断发展变化的数据库技术和需求。